Transaction 376e5da78899d8bcdd8cf54de85c7619d6ca2c69fbf30e2380850d94f7731da5

2 Input
2 Outputs
  • 376e5da78899d8bcdd8cf54de85c7619d6ca2c69fbf30e2380850d94f7731da5:0
  • value  2331655
    address  18dm1xoXVpCzthbzxqkVEsRyrZxjaLknyc
  • 376e5da78899d8bcdd8cf54de85c7619d6ca2c69fbf30e2380850d94f7731da5:1
  • value  67359
    address  18rcWiLZri5TBoxGKqCPGXTFTAjfYtaXaf